SBP holds sports women's seminar to mark Int'l Women's Day.

LAHORE -- The Sports Board Punjab (SBP) organized an impressive Women's Seminar in connection with International Women's Day at Nishtar Park Sports Complex (NPSC) ELibrary on Wednesday. Secretary Sports and Youth Affairs Punjab Shahid Zaman, Deputy Commissioner Lahore Rafia Haider, Director General Sports Punjab Muhammad Tariq Qureshi, Dr. Asma Shami, ex-Chairperson Ladies Golf, were the guests of honour at the largely-attended seminar. Former and current female sports players and officials, students of different colleges and universities, women from various departments including Rescue 1122 and important personalities also participated in the seminar. Addressing the seminar, Secretary Sports and Youth Affairs Punjab Shahid Zaman said that women have an imperative role in every field of life. 'No society could be completed without women. The provincial metropolis Lahore is being administered by a competent woman DC Lahore Rafia Haider. Our young girls must take inspiration from her.'

The Secretary Sports said Punjab govt is taking effective measures for making women self-reliant and independent under e-Rozgar Programme. 'Our talented girl Bisma has earned a hefty amount of over Rs 3 million in three-year time from e-Rozgar Programme.' In her address, Deputy Commissioner Lahore Rafia Haider said: 'Women need to put up more efforts to become respectable and dignified citizens.
